Artist's Description

Steel dock, used mostly by the local tug boats. Shot just as the sun was setting, with some fog rolling in. Using a 120 sec exposure provides this nice, silky smooth water, with nice colors.

About Tony Locke

Tony Locke

Living in the Pacific Northwest, on an island about 1.5 hours North of Seattle, WA, there are endless beauties of nature to capture. From the waters of Puget Sound to the San Juan Islands, the Cascade Mountains and British Columbia, Canada just up the road, I love to explore and photograph all there is to see. I also enjoy teaching others the art of photography, Photoshop and Lightroom, so that they too can enjoy all there is to see and capture.
